Foll Cure


This is an anti dandruff treatment with follicle therapy enhancers. Especially made for those who have a dandruff problem. I had a dandruff problem and a really stubborn one, there was nothing I didn't do to stop the dandruff coming back but it just did. Later I got the Foll Cure shampoo and I must say that I saw results from the first go, after a month my dandruff went away completely! 
The instructions say to apply after your hair is wet then massage it into the scalp and leave it for 5 minutes for treatment and residual action. Finally rinse it away with water. Use it 2-3 times a week and followed by once or twice weekly for maintenance. 
Also I would mention that don't forget to use a conditioner after using this shampoo. I have been using this for the past two years so if you can get your hands on this I suggest you do and deal with that dandruff. :)
